Anchor Spot
Where we dropped our hook:
33º 23.1203′ N 118º 28.5641′ W
In around 20 feet
Holding
Sand bottom, good holding.
Set a stern hook to keep bow towards mouth of bay and into the swell.
Dinghy Landing
Easy beach landing.
The reef at the mouth of the anchorage protects the beach in most weather conditions.
Amenities
None.
There is a campground near by. The campers may or may not let you use their outdoor shower (it’s cold) and fill up with some water.

Weather
While we were there, the weather was warm, but the wind did switch. Because we did not put out a stern hook, Prism swung and was very close to the braking waves over the rock reef that protects the anchorage.
